Abstract

The utility model provides a dust humidifying and settling device for a chemical production workshop, which relates to the technical field of dust removal equipment and comprises a main body, wherein a filtering baffle is arranged inside the main body, a movable lead screw is arranged inside the main body and movably connected with the main body, a reciprocating motor is arranged on the side surface of the main body, the output end of the reciprocating motor penetrates through the side surface of the main body, the output end of the reciprocating motor is connected with one end of the movable lead screw, a scraper is arranged in the main body and movably connected with the main body, the scraper is in threaded connection with the movable lead screw, dust collection boxes are arranged on two sides of the main body and penetrate through the side surface of the main body, a movable lead screw and a scraper are arranged in the main body, when dust in the workshop enters the main body and is settled on the filtering baffle, the reciprocating motor can drive the movable lead screw to move the scraper on the top surface of the filtering baffle, and scrape the dust accumulated on the filtering baffle into the dust collection boxes, the design enables dust in the workshop to be collected and processed, prevents the dust from diffusing again, and improves the dust removal efficiency.

referring to fig. 1-4, a dust humidifying and settling device for a chemical production workshop comprises a main body 1, a filtering partition plate 15 is arranged inside the main body 1, a movable screw rod 17 is arranged inside the main body 1, the movable screw rod 17 is movably connected with the main body 1, a reciprocating motor 7 is arranged on the side surface of the main body 1, the output end of the reciprocating motor 7 penetrates through the side surface of the main body 1, the output end of the reciprocating motor 7 is connected with one end of the movable screw rod 17, a scraper 16 is arranged in the main body 1, the scraper 16 is movably connected with the main body 1, the scraper 16 is in threaded connection with the movable screw rod 17, dust collecting boxes 4 are arranged on two sides of the main body 1, and the dust collecting boxes 4 penetrate through the side surface of the main body 1.
The dust collecting box 4 is in an axisymmetric structure relative to the main body 1, a collecting box 8 is arranged inside the dust collecting box 4, the collecting box 8 is movably connected with the dust collecting box 4, and the collecting box 8 penetrates through the surface of the dust collecting box 4. The side of main part 1 is equipped with inlet air channel 13, and inlet air channel 13 runs through the main part 1 side, and the bottom surface array of main part 1 is equipped with universal wheel 5. The side of main part 1 is equipped with rose box 2, and rose box 2 runs through the 1 side of main part, and the side of rose box 2 is equipped with exhaust fan 3, and exhaust fan 3 runs through 2 surfaces of rose box, and the side of rose box 2 is equipped with filter 9, and filter 9 and 2 swing joint of rose box. Be equipped with mounting panel 10 in the main part 1, the bottom surface of mounting panel 10 is equipped with cloth liquid pipe 11, and the inside of main part 1 is equipped with liquid reserve tank 19, and the inside bottom surface of liquid reserve tank 19 is equipped with circulating pump 14, is equipped with circulating pipe 18 between circulating pump 14 and the cloth liquid pipe 11, and circulating pipe 18 runs through main part 1 and mounting panel 10 respectively, and the bottom surface array of cloth liquid pipe 11 is equipped with atomizing nozzle 12, and atomizing nozzle 12 runs through cloth liquid pipe 11. The front of the main body 1 is provided with a controller 6, and the controller 6 is electrically connected with the exhaust fan 3, the reciprocating motor 7 and the circulating pump 14 respectively.
The utility model discloses a theory of operation: the main body 1 can move in a workshop through the universal wheel 5, in the moving process, the controller 6 controls the exhaust fan 3 to work, dust in the workshop can enter the main body 1 through the air inlet channel 13, then the circulating pump 14 conveys water in the liquid storage tank 19 into the liquid distribution pipe 11 through the circulating pipe 18, then the dust in the main body 1 is humidified and settled through the atomizing nozzle 12 and then is discharged through the dust collection tank 4, the filter plate 9 in the dust collection tank 4 carries out secondary filtration on gas, the main body 1 is internally provided with the movable screw rod 17 and the scraper 16, when the dust in the workshop enters the main body 1 and is settled on the filter partition plate 15, the reciprocating motor 7 can drive the movable screw rod 17 to move the scraper 16 on the top surface of the filter partition plate 15, dust accumulated on the filter partition plate 15 is scraped into the dust collection tank 4, the design can collect and process the dust in the workshop, and avoid secondary diffusion of the dust, the dust removal efficiency is improved.
